Free Shawnee Riverfest concert returns Sunday

Shawnee Riverfest VIII returns on Sunday for a day filled with music, family and fun to support The Pocono Mountains United Way.

The free, eight-hour concert kicks off at 11:30 a.m. on the great lawn of the historic Shawnee Inn and Golf Resort.

Over 18 international, national and local acts will come together to perform and support our community.

This year’s roster includes: Chel, Wild Planes, Kayla Nicole, Fusia Dance Company, Brian Jai, Turbo Goth, Pocono Great Talent Event Winner Jocely Berrios, First of June, Grace Morrison, Nik Hartfield, DJ QEUE, Melissa Otero, Jackson Howard, Mandala, Yaniza, Shawnee Playhouse Cast of Hairspray Jr. and Mama Mia, Deanna Badik, and Ariana Hernandez.

These talented artists are ready to perform on the stage being set by The Sherman Theater.

The event will also have food vendors, auction items, bounce houses, face painting and an outdoor photo booth.

“We are so excited to support the new Pocono Mountains United Way, because we know these resources will positively impact our community,” event organizer Gil Coronado, of CILA llc Management, said.

The weekend will also include two other events to support the United Way on Saturday.

The Race & Zumba 2 Riverfest Event will take place in the morning at Phoenix Athletica in Pocono Summit and includes a fundraising cycling event on one floor and a Zumba Event on another floor.

The Free Riverfest Pre-Party will take place Saturday evening at the Sycamore Grille in the Delaware Water Gap where the public and sponsors will get a sneak peek at the talented Riverfest musicians during an intimate evening of fundraising and entertainment.

“We are thankful to Gil, CILA Management, Phoenix Athletica and the amazing event sponsors for their dedication to helping the United Way and our community,” Pocono Mountains United Way President/CEO Michael Tukeva said.
